The Eskomos mascot, used by Esko Public Schools in Minnesota, is a unique and intriguing one. The name "Eskomos" is a play on the word "Eskimos," which refers to the Inuit people living in Arctic regions. This mascot was chosen to reflect toughness and resilience, much like the harsh yet beautiful Arctic environment. However, due to a new Minnesota law aimed at respecting Native American identities, the school has decided to retire the Eskomos nickname and its associated igloo logo as of June 30, 2023[4। Despite the upcoming change, the spirit behind the Eskomos has always been about embodying strong character traits like hard work and intelligence, qualities that are highly valued in student athletes.
